What Is AEO and Why Does It Matter for Fresno Law Firms?
Search behavior has shifted dramatically. A growing share of people looking for a personal injury attorney, a family law specialist, or a criminal defense lawyer in Fresno no longer scroll through ten blue links. They type a question — “What should I do after a car accident in Fresno?” — and an AI engine answers it directly, often citing one or two sources. The firm whose page gets cited wins the credibility, and frequently the client.
Traditional SEO gets you ranked. AEO gets you cited. Both matter, but AEO is the faster path to appearing in zero-click answers and AI-generated summaries, which are now at the top of the page for most legal queries. How AI Engines Decide Whose Content to Surface
AI answer engines prioritize content that is authoritative, structured, and directly answers a specific question. For law firms, that means your website needs pages that open with a clear, concise answer to a legal question your prospective clients are actually asking. It means using proper schema markup so search engines can parse your content as a legitimate legal resource. It means building topical authority across a cluster of related questions — not just one generic “About Us” page and a contact form.
Google’s own guidance on structured data makes clear that well-marked-up, answer-forward content is more likely to be understood and surfaced by its systems. That guidance applies doubly now that AI Overviews are baked into nearly every informational search result.

What a Law Firm AEO Strategy Actually Looks Like
AEO for law firms isn’t about stuffing your site with generic Q&A content. It’s a deliberate, layered process built around the questions your specific clients ask — in your specific market.
Step 1: Question Research Rooted in Fresno’s Legal Landscape
The starting point is identifying the exact questions Fresno-area residents are asking AI tools and search engines. These are rarely the broad, generic queries law firm content teams default to. They’re specific: “How long do I have to file a personal injury claim in California?” or “What happens at an arraignment in Fresno County Superior Court?” Your content needs to answer these questions directly, accurately, and in plain language.
Step 2: Structured Content That AI Can Parse
Every high-priority practice area on your site should have a dedicated page that opens with a direct answer, uses FAQ schema markup, and builds out the topic in depth. AI engines favor content that is easy to parse — short, declarative sentences at the top of the page, followed by supporting detail. This structure serves both the AI engine and the actual human client who lands on the page.
Step 3: Authority Signals That Fresno Clients Trust
AEO doesn’t work in isolation. AI engines cross-reference your content against your broader authority signals: your Google Business Profile, your reviews on Avvo and Google, mentions in local Fresno Bee coverage or Central Valley Bar Association materials, and the quality of sites linking to you. A strong AEO strategy reinforces all of these, not just the on-page content layer.
Step 4: Monitoring and Iteration
AI answer engines update their outputs constantly. A citation you earned this quarter can disappear if a competitor publishes better-structured content on the same topic. What does AEO mean for a law firm?
AEO stands for Answer Engine Optimization. It means structuring your law firm’s website content so that AI-powered tools — like Google’s AI Overviews, Bing Copilot, and ChatGPT — recognize your pages as authoritative answers to legal questions and cite your firm in their responses.
How is AEO different from SEO for attorneys?
SEO focuses on ranking your pages in traditional search results so users click through to your site. AEO focuses on getting your content cited directly inside AI-generated answer summaries — so your firm’s name appears even before a user clicks anything. Both strategies work together, but AEO specifically targets the zero-click, AI-answer layer of modern search.
Is AEO relevant for small or solo law firms in Fresno?
Yes — often more so than for large firms. Smaller firms typically have more flexibility to publish niche, question-specific content that directly answers the queries local clients ask. A solo family law attorney in River Park who answers very specific Fresno County divorce questions can out-cite a larger generalist firm with a bloated, generic website.
How long does it take to see AEO results for a Fresno law firm?
Most firms begin seeing citation appearances in AI Overviews and similar tools within six to twelve weeks of implementing a structured AEO content build. The timeline varies based on how competitive the practice area is and how much existing content your site already has to build on.
Does AEO work for every practice area?
AEO is particularly effective for practice areas that generate high volumes of informational questions — personal injury, family law, criminal defense, employment law, and immigration. Practice areas that are more referral-driven or B2B-focused may see a smaller direct impact, though the authority signals AEO builds still benefit the overall site.
